Tex. Insurance Code § 543.052: CRIMINAL PENALTY.

(a) A person commits an offense if the person violates Subchapter A.
(b) An offense under this section is a Class A misdemeanor.
(c) The penalty provided by this section is in addition to any other penalty specifically provided by law.
Added by Acts 2003, 78th Leg., ch. 1274, Sec. 2, eff. April 1, 2005.
